Approving the application of Stone Saloon, SBC dba Waldmann Brewery, Waldmann Oktoberfest event series, Fridays, September 19 and 26; Saturdays, September 20, and 27; Sundays, September 21 and 28; for a sound level variance in order to present live amplified sound at Waldmann Brewery, 445 Smith Avenue N.

WHEREAS, Chapter 293 of the Saint Paul Legislative Code was enacted to regulate the subject of noise in the City of Saint Paul; and
WHEREAS, §293.09 provides for the granting of variances from the sound level limitations contained in
§293.07, upon a finding by the City Council that full compliance with Chapter 293 would constitute an unreasonable hardship on the applicant, other persons or on the community; and
WHEREAS, Stone Saloon, SBC dba Waldmann Brewery, represented by Tom Schroeder, President/CEO, who has been designated as the responsible person on the application, has applied for a variance, at a requested sound level limit of 85 dBA at no specified distance, to present live amplified sound for the Waldmann Oktoberfest event series on Fridays, September 19 and September 26; and Saturdays, September 20, and September 27, 2025; and from 12:00 p.m. until 7:00 p.m. on Sundays, September 21 and September 28, 2025, with a pre-event sound check at 11:00 a.m. on all dates at the Stone Saloon, SBC dba Waldmann Brewery, 445 Smith Avenue N; and
WHEREAS, applicant has requested a variance for the hours of 12:00 p.m. until 10:00 p.m. on Fridays, September 19 and September 26 and Saturdays, September 20, and September 27, 2025; and from 12:00 p.m. until 7:00 p.m. on Sundays, September 21 and September 28, 2025, with a pre-event sound check at 11:00 a.m. on all dates for a Stone Saloon, SBC dba Waldmann Brewery, Waldmann Oktoberfest event series; and
WHEREAS, if applicant is not granted a variance applicant will not be able to present amplified sound at the Stone Saloon, SBC dba Waldmann Brewery, 445 Smith Avenue N; and
WHEREAS, the Department of Safety and Inspections has reviewed the application and has made recommendations regarding conditions for the variances. Now, therefore, be it
RESOLVED, that the Council of the City of Saint Paul hereby grants a variance to Stone Saloon, SBC dba Waldmann Brewery, subject to the following conditions:
1) The Variance shall be for the requested variance hours of 12:00 p.m. until 10:00 p.m. on Fridays, September 19 and September 26 and Saturdays, September 20, and September 27, 2025; and from 12:00 p.m. until 7:00 p.m. on Sundays, September 21 and September 28, 2025, with a pre-event sound check at 11:00 a.m. on all dates for a Stone Saloon, SBC dba Waldmann Brewery, Waldmann Oktoberfest event series; and
2) All electronically powered equipment used in conjunction with the event shall not exceed 85 dBA at 50 feet from all sound sources during the September 19 - September 21 and September 26-September 28, 2025 event dates and times; and
3) The applicant shall monitor the decibel level from the variance approved distance of each noise source and create a report that records the general operating decibel levels within 15 minutes of the start of each performing act and at intervals no greater than 60 minutes apart thereafter. The report shall be made available for viewing by city staff, upon request during the variance or within 30 days thereafter. Applicant shall also conduct a decibel reading during the variance upon request of city staff.
4) All electronically powered equipment, PA systems, loudspeakers or similar devices shall be turned off no later than 9:59 p.m. on September 19, September 20, September 26 and September 27, 2025 and no later than 7:00 p.m. on September 21 and September 28, 2025, the event dates.
FURTHER RESOLVED, that any violations of the conditions set forth above on the September 19, September 20, September 21, September 26, September 27 and September 28, 2025 dates may result in denial of future requests for the grant of a noise variance, in addition to any criminal citation which might issue.
